What Makes a Great Cot Bed?
Before diving into the top designs, it is essential to comprehend the key criteria that separate an excellent cot bed from a terrific one. When shopping in the UK, moms and dads ought to assess products based upon the following:
Safety Standards: All cot beds sold in the UK should comply with British security standards (BS EN 716 for cots and BS 8509 for children's beds). Bed Mattress Base Heights: Look for adjustable base levels. A greater setting is vital for securing the parents' backs when lifting a newborn, while lower settings avoid adventurous young children from climbing up out.Resilience and Materials: Solid wood (like pine, beech, or oak) uses longevity, while crafted wood provides a sleek, modern-day finish.Conversion Ease: A good cot bed ought to come with clear instructions and conversion packages consisted of (or easily available) to make the transition from baby to toddler smooth.Leading Cot Bed Contenders in the UK

without any gaps. Consider Storage: Nurseries can rapidly become chaotic. Cot beds with built-in drawers below are wonderful forsaving extra bed linen, muslins, or out-of-season clothing. Teething Rails: Babies enjoy to chew on furniture when their teeth begin coming in. Search for cot beds with teething rails-- smooth plastic strips along the leading edges-- to safeguard the wood and your baby's gums.Space Dimensions: Cot beds are larger than basic cots. Measure the nursery space thoroughly, ensuring there is a lot of room to walk around the bed once put together. Frequently Asked Questions(FAQ)Q: What is the difference in between a cot and a cot bed? A: A standard cot is smaller and generally utilized until a kid is around 18 months to 2 years of ages. A cot bed is larger, uses a basic young child bed mattress size(140 x 70 cm), and includes detachable sides and end panels so it can convert into a toddler bed as the child grows. Q: Do I require a special bed mattress for a cot bed? A: Yes. Cot beds require a bigger mattressthan basic cots. It is essential that the bed mattress is firm, flat, and fits the cot bed frame comfortably without any gaps larger than 3cm on any side to meet UK safe sleep standards( the Lullaby Trust recommendations). Q: When should I transform the cot bed into a young child bed? A: Most moms and dads make the transition in between 18 months and 3 years old. Key signs that it is time to convert include the child tryingto climb up out of the cot, or if they have
officially outgrown the cot lengthways. Q: Are cot beds tough to assemble? A: Difficulty differs by brand. Many flat-pack cot beds take between one to two hours to assemble. It is always advised to develop the cot bed inside the room where it will be used, as fully put together cot beds are often too broad
to fit through standard doorways. Last Thoughts Buying the best cot bed provides assurance for parents and a comfy, safe sleeping environment for the baby.
